Which of the following statements describe accurate information about family-focused communication? A nurse's communication with a family:
 
  1. Usually focuses on the individual family member with an illness.
  2. Usually begins with a nurse sharing personal information.
  3. Aims to develop a caring relationship that sees the individual and family as the unit of care.
  4. Most often requires a nurse to determine the direction for family-focused communication.

Answer to Question 1

ANS: 3

Feedback
1 Family-focused communication addresses a family member with an illness as well as the family.
2 A nurse sharing personal information sets a tone of the nurse being focused on self, rather than the family.
3 Family-focused communication addresses the need for nurses to care for individuals and the family.
4 The family often identifies the direction and priority for communication.

Answer to Question 2

ANS:

Element of communication Examples of Family Communication
Communicators The nurse strives to develop a partnership with the individual and family.
Context Nurse provides information to family in a complex and foreign health-care setting.
Critical Thought Nurse uses questioning techniques to identify unique family experiences and meanings.
Message Identify family's usual communication patterns and how illness is impacting their relationship and communication.
Method Nurse communicates with a family in a meeting, or refers family to an online social support system.
Assign Meaning Explore the individual differences in a family.
Effects Dialogue with family about how individual's illness impacts the family unit.
Feedback Provide family members with praises for their strengths.
Rationale:
Multiple examples of family communication could be used to demonstrate family-focused communication.

The use of salicylates dates back 2,500 years to Hippocrates's recommendation of willow bark (from which a salicylate is derived) as an aid to the pains of childbirth. However, overdosage of salicylates can harm body fluids, electrolytes, the CNS, the GI tract, the ears, the lungs, the blood, the liver, and the kidneys and cause coma or death.

Giardia is one of the most common intestinal parasites worldwide, and infects up to 20% of the world population, mostly in poorer countries with inadequate sanitation. Infections are most common in children, though chronic Giardia is more common in adults.
